Commit 7708992 ("xen/blkback: Seperate the bio allocation and the bio submission") consolidated the pendcnt updates to just a single write, neglecting the fact that the error path relied on it getting set to 1 up front (such that the decrement in __end_block_io_op() would actually drop the count to zero, triggering the necessary cleanup actions). Also remove a misleading and a stale (after said commit) comment.
